LeBron James, known as “The King,” has carved out a monumental career that spans multiple teams and championships. From his early days as a prodigious talent straight out of high school to becoming a dominant force on the Cleveland Cavaliers, Miami Heat, and Los Angeles Lakers, James has redefined the role of a versatile forward in the modern NBA. With four NBA championships, multiple MVP awards, and a record-breaking list of achievements, LeBron James has cemented his legacy as one of the game’s all-time greats.

Kobe Bryant, on the other hand, embodied the relentless pursuit of perfection and a tireless work ethic that mirrored Jordan’s own approach to the game. Bryant’s tenure with the Los Angeles Lakers saw him win five NBA championships, earn numerous All-Star selections, and solidify his status as a generational talent. His “Mamba Mentality”—a mindset of unwavering focus, determination, and resilience—endeared him to fans worldwide and left an indelible mark on the sport.

Jordan has acknowledged LeBron James’s versatility and ability to impact the game in multiple facets. LeBron’s combination of size, athleticism, basketball IQ, and playmaking skills has made him a formidable opponent on both ends of the court. Jordan has praised LeBron’s leadership abilities and his knack for elevating his teammates, qualities that have enabled him to succeed in various team environments throughout his career.

Regarding Kobe Bryant, Jordan has spoken fondly of their relationship both on and off the court. Bryant, who idolized Jordan growing up, patterned his game after the Chicago Bulls legend and sought mentorship from him during his own career. Jordan has commended Bryant for his dedication to mastering his craft, noting his relentless work ethic and commitment to excellence as key factors in his success.
